INTERNAL MEMO — Finance Team

Re: Customer-Support Outsourcing Plan

Leadership has approved moving tier-one support for the Quillex platform to an external provider, Harrowden Services, starting next quarter. Expected annual savings are in the mid six figures, with transition costs front-loaded. Headcount impacts are still being finalised. Further detail on the wider plan appears in the note below.

board note of bawep-tajef: Queniusek Systems plans to raise the Quenvan list price by 53.1 percent in March. The pricing group signed off on a budget of $176.4 million for Project Drueth. The renewal with Casionix Partners closes at $142.5 million a year, 8.3 percent below the last contract. Project Fraax slips by six weeks because of the tooling delay.

// TAX_CACHE_TTL_SECONDS
//
// Controls how long Ledgerpine caches jurisdiction tax rates before
// refetching from the rates service. Lowering this increases load on
// the upstream service; raising it risks serving stale rates after a
// mid-quarter change. On-call: if you see stale-rate alerts, do NOT
// just bump this down — flush the cache via the admin task instead,
// then confirm the rates service is healthy. The value was last tuned
// during the Q3 incident. The build where the fix landed is below.

build token for bajog-yaduf: htk9_39788324c

**Facilities Ticket — Holiday Opening Hours, Marrow Street Office**

Quick heads-up for new starters: over the Wintermas break the building runs reduced hours — open 08:00 to 16:00, and fully closed on the two bank holidays. The main doors are locked outside those times, but the side entrance on Cobb Lane stays available for anyone who needs to pop in. You'll need the side-door entry code, which is:

badge for hahip-bagag: bdg-FIJ-9

# Lintmarsh: Limits & Quotas

Lintmarsh is the documentation linter for all Fernhollow repos. It runs on every push. Hard limits: it will not scan files over the size cap, will not follow more than the link-depth cap, and will abort a run past the wall-clock ceiling. Do not raise limits in repo config without asking the docs platform team first. Current enforced values are listed here.

tuning table, kajog-kawef:
PRIORITIES = {
    "kelox": 870,
    "kasix": 89,
    "eliax": 988,
}